Desha County is a rural county in Arkansas, spanning 741 square miles with 11,041 residents at a density of 14.9 people per square mile, so rural land and genuine privacy are available. The agricultural economy is rated strong, built on soybeans, cotton, corn. A median home price of $89,000 and an effective property tax rate of 0.58% set the cost of entry. The climate sits in USDA hardiness zone 8b with a 239-day growing season, average summer highs of 90.7°F and average winter lows of 35°F. Annual rainfall averages 51.9 inches, and with drought risk rated very high, water storage and irrigation planning matter. Delta Memorial Hospital is 13.9 miles away and includes an emergency room. Broadband reaches 86.1% of homes. On the hazard side, tornado risk is high, drought risk is very high, so plan infrastructure and insurance accordingly.

Pros

  • A long 239-day growing season in USDA zone 8b supports a wide range of crops and multiple plantings.
  • A low effective property tax rate of 0.58% holds annual carrying costs down.
  • A median home price of $89,000 makes land and property relatively affordable.
  • A strong agricultural economy built on soybeans, cotton, corn means local markets, equipment, and know-how are in place.
  • At 14.9 people per square mile, land is available with genuine space and privacy.

Cons

  • Drought risk is very high, making water storage and irrigation infrastructure essential rather than optional.
  • A poverty rate of 28.9% reflects a constrained local economy with limited off-farm income options.
